Usually people prefer to invest in value added products and minor products are ignored by them. Needle is little thing, it is major need of every house hold unfortunately people hesitate to invest this industry and this product is imported from abroad. To meet demands of Hajjis Saudi Arabia imports bulk amounts of prayer rosaries from other countries. During month of Ramadan millions of Date seeds are thrown away every day. Every seed can be converted to manufacturing of Rosary or Tasbih and this work is still being made somewhere by machine or by traditionally  or as an alive culture by prisoners in jails.

 Huge amounts of Olive seeds are fall on grounds and then go waste in the amount of tons from hilly areas also Olive leave are being wasted after falling and drying. Value added fruit trees are protected by the people while the forest trees are usually known as useless. Tasbih or Rosary made from olive seeds is preferred by Muslims over all others since olive (and its tree) has been mentioned a number of times both in Quran and Hadith. For this reason, olive is considered a “blessed” fruit by them. Small-size olives, as raw material for the product, are found all over hilly areas of the country which are being wasted in huge amounts. If gathered in large quantity and utilized properly, we could produce Tasbihs to meet ever increasing demand of Hajjis. Hilly areas of Pakistan have more than 8 million trees of wild olive. 1 to 3 kg of olive fruit can be obtained from a single tree during the season.

One kg of fruit is needed to make 100 Tasbihs, each containing 100 beads. Instead of felling a tree and losing it forever, to sell its wood for Rupees 5000 to 6000, a farmer can earn Rupees 10,000 to 50,000 from it every year through its fruit.  He can also earn alternate money by the productivity of Olive leaves and branches products. Another area of waste reduction is through utilization of extremely large scale of empty plastic milk packets and bags which are thrown away every day. These can be utilized in the production of several items. Up-cycling is one process that can be helpful for reducing pollution.
